MASHUA

Etymology 1

Noun

mashua (plural mashuas)

A root vegetable grown in the Andes, Tropaeolum tuberosum.

Etymology 2

Noun

mashua (plural mashuas)

A type of simple fishing vessel found on the coast of East Africa.
